Is there a particular stand mixer you would recommend for my daughter who has a strong interest in baking?
@LisaCooksFood
3 жыл бұрын
I’ve had this Kitchen Aid Artisan for 15+ years. It’s on its way out and the repair is as expensive as a new one, but I feel good about having gotten my money’s worth. I’ll replace it with another Kitchen Aid when the time comes. Having said that, if she’s interested in bread making, she’ll need more than the Classic Kitchen Aid. At least an Artisan or fancier. If she’s interested in making larger cakes (wedding cakes), she’ll do better with the largest capacity. I often find my standard size too small for my larger batches, but I think you need both at that point. Regular size for small-medium baking and the larger size for large cakes/breads. Also, I prefer the tilt head format to the bowl lift format, but it is a matter of personal preference.
